Although Juve have had the agony of losing the title to Barcelona 3-1, these two teams go back a long way. In recent years, there have been a number of players who have played together for both giants. Today Jerk will count these players for you.

Alves (name)

Alves joined Barcelona in July 2008 for a transfer fee of €35.5 million, winning 2 trebles with the team and was a decorated player for Barcelona. On June 28, 2016, he moved to Juventus on a free transfer. The Champions League quarter-final, against his old master Barcelona, I believe he will have a great performance.

Zambrotta, Spain

In the 1999-00 season, the unknown Zambrotta moved from Bari to Juventus, where he stayed for seven years; in the 2001-02 season, he won his first Serie A title under Lippi. In the 2006-07 season, he moved to Barcelona, where he won the Champions League with the team (manager Rijkaard) that season!

Thuram (name)

In the 2001-02 season, Toulam joined Juventus along with teammate Gianluigi Buffon, with a transfer fee of £22 million as the most expensive defender at the time; he stayed at Juve for five years and won three league titles. In the 2006-07 season, affected by the Juve phone-gate incident, Toulam transferred to Barcelona (5 million low price). In August 2008, he announced his retirement due to health reasons.

Sorin (name)

Defender Sorin joined Juve for the 1995-1996 season, but he made only 2 appearances. 1997-98 returned to Argentina's River Plate. He joined Barcelona in 2002-2003, making 15 appearances and scoring 1 goal, before joining Paris Saint-Germain the following year. On July 29, 2009, at the age of 33, Sorin retired.

Laudrup (name)

Michel Laudrup played for Juventus from 1985/86 to 1988/89, when, together with Platini, he helped Juve win their first European Cup. He then played for Barcelona from 1989/90 to 1993/94 before moving to Real Madrid. In the five seasons he played for Barcelona, he helped them win the La Liga title for four consecutive years, and in 1992 he won the Champions League for the first time!
